In this video, Michael 'The Gator Crusader' demonstrates the power and ferocity of an alligator’s bite. Strapping a GoPro to his head, he allows the man-eating alligator to bite on the camera. This dangerous activity appears to be happening more frequently; a man in a T-Rex costume decided to tease an alligator, and a man in Bangkok effectively fed himself to one.

We shouldn't have to tell you this, but please don't try this. Ever. In the wild, at a zoo, or even if an alligator breaks into your home, just leave it well alone, and don't try and stick your head in its mouth.
